An FMU and a UTEC are two totaly different things. You obviously know what a UTEC is if you have one, but a FMU is what they call a Fuel Management Unit. They normaly are some type of rising rate fuel pressure regulator. And if you have the Utec, you should not need the FMU. If you are going with forced induction I would highly recommend a return style fuel rail system.
